Princeton class of 1882 graduate Thomas Peebles moved to Minnesota in 1884, and transplanted the idea of organized crowds cheering at football games to the University of Minnesota.
However, it was not until 1898 that University of Minnesota student Johnny Campbell directed a crowd in cheering " Rah, Rah, Rah!
Soon after, the University of Minnesota organized a " yell leader " squad of six male students, who still use Campbell's original cheer.

The University of Minnesota, Twin Cities ( U of M ) is a public research university located in Minneapolis and St. Paul, Minnesota, United States.
The University of Minnesota, Twin Cities is considered a Public Ivy, or a public institution that offers an education comparable to those of the Ivy League.
According to the College Board, as of July 2012 there are 34, 812 undergraduates at the University of Minnesota Twin Cities campus.
The University of MinnesotaTwin Cities campus has the second largest number of graduate and professional students in the United States at over 16, 000.
